14:22 — Confirmed divergence: the Skylark Android SDK shipped retry-with-jitter in 4.2, but the iOS SDK's equivalent was silently gated behind an unreleased flag, so partner apps saw inconsistent backoff behavior under load. Priya verified both SDKs against the parity matrix and flagged the gap for the next coordinated release. The relevant build reference follows.

build token for kagaf-hahof: htk14_9d3d4d26d7d8de

## Deploying the Gatewick Proctor Queue

Deploys are pretty painless: push to main, wait for the pipeline, then watch the queue drain dashboard for five minutes. If candidates pile up mid-exam, roll back first and ask questions later — the queue replays safely. Everything the workers care about lives in one config block, shown here for reference.

settings of bafof-yagef:
JOROX_PIN=8740
JOROX_TENANT=pelox
JOROX_METRICS_HOST=metrics.jorox.qorvelworks.internal
JOROX_SEAL=seal_c78f63c1
JOROX_STANDBY_TEAM=norax

Subject: Turnstile counter cut-over complete

Team — the Gatewise counter at Bramford Arena is now fully cut over to the new ingest pipeline. Legacy polling is disabled, and counts reconciled within 0.2% across last night's event. If a gate reports zeros, restart the edge agent before escalating. For anyone joining on-call this week, the service now runs with these values.

service settings:
novath:
  pin: 1396
  tenant: pelys
  seal: seal_ccc035e1
  metrics_host: metrics.novath.qorvelworks.test
  standby_team: fraeth
  escalation: drueth-zorok
  nonce: 61d508